Output f5e21f4e71899a35a43941366faf2bc9cdaaf05137b74d45746f7824c73d5920:15

value
12071875
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 646282e52de18f9df9ff584b83fedd56e20916a22e427a80cc0f9bd5aa617db3
address
tb1pv33g9efdux8em70ltp9c8lka2m3qj94z9ep84qxvp7dat2np0kesq7lykn
transaction
f5e21f4e71899a35a43941366faf2bc9cdaaf05137b74d45746f7824c73d5920
confirmations
30931
spent
true